1. Flour Power: The backbone of the cookie empire

Flour is the foundation upon which your chocolate chip cookies are built. Opt for all-purpose flour for a classic and versatile choice, or experiment with alternative flours like whole wheat or almond flour for a unique twist. Remember, different flours may alter the texture and flavor of your cookies, so tread carefully on this floury journey.

  • Remember to sift your flour to avoid lumpy cookies.
  • Spoon and level your flour when measuring to achieve accurate proportions.

2. Sweet Symphony: Dancing with sugars

Sugar adds the necessary sweetness and chewiness to our beloved cookies. When it comes to chocolate chip cookies, you have two key players: granulated sugar and brown sugar. While granulated sugar lends a crisp texture, brown sugar adds a chewy and caramel-like flavor profile. Strike the perfect balance between the two for an exquisite taste.

  • Use more brown sugar for a chewier cookie or more granulated sugar for a crisper texture.
  • To prevent your brown sugar from turning into a rock-hard boulder, store it with a slice of bread or a marshmallow.

3. Butter: The golden elixir of cookie magic

Butter, oh glorious butter! The richness and flavor it imparts to our cookies are simply unrivaled. For the ultimate chocolate chip cookie experience, opt for unsalted butter. This allows you to control the saltiness of your cookies and ensures a clean, pure taste.

  • Let your butter soften at room temperature before creaming it with the sugars.
  • Overly melted or overly chilled butter may yield different results, so aim for that perfect softness.

4. Egg-cellence: Binding our dough together

Eggs play a crucial role in the chemistry of baking, acting as the binder that holds our cookie

dough together. Use large eggs in your recipe, unless you’re after a specific texture alteration.

  • Room temperature eggs blend more easily into the dough.
  • To separate egg yolks from whites, you can use the shell as a cute little yolk catcher or a fancy egg separator tool.

5. Vanilla Essence: A touch of liquid gold

Vanilla extract, that delightful aromatic essence, elevates the flavor profile of your cookies to celestial heights. A dash of pure vanilla extract is all you need to make your taste buds sing.

6. Baking Soda: The leavening hero

Baking soda acts as a leavening agent, giving our cookies a tender and fluffy texture. It’s the secret ingredient that allows our cookies to rise and develop those beautiful cracks on the surface.

  • Be cautious when measuring baking soda; a little goes a long way!
  • Keep your baking soda fresh by testing its effectiveness in vinegar (fizzing is a good sign).

7. Chocolate Chip Selection: The treasure within

The star of the show—chocolate chips! Choose your chocolate chips wisely, for they will determine the ultimate taste and texture of your cookies. Classic semi-sweet chocolate chips are a safe bet, but don’t be afraid to venture into the realms of dark chocolate, milk chocolate, or even white chocolate for a twist.

  • For a gooey center, use chocolate chunks instead of regular chocolate chips.
  • If you can resist the temptation, chop your own chocolate from a high-quality bar for an artisanal touch.

1. Types of Chocolate Chips: Exploring the cocoa spectrum

When it comes to chocolate chips, the possibilities are as vast as the Milky Way. Let’s take a peek at some popular options:

  • Semi-sweet Chocolate Chips: The classic choice that strikes a delightful balance between sweetness and richness. Perfect for those who prefer a traditional chocolate chip cookie experience.
  • Dark Chocolate Chips: For the bittersweet aficionados, dark chocolate chips lend an intense, sophisticated flavor to your cookies. Ideal for those who enjoy a deeper, more pronounced cocoa taste.
  • Milk Chocolate Chips: Indulge in the creamy sweetness of milk chocolate chips, adding a touch of nostalgia and comfort to your cookies. Ideal for those with a sweet tooth.
  • White Chocolate Chips: While technically not chocolate (it’s made from cocoa butter), white chocolate chips offer a creamy and mellow flavor that complements other ingredients. Ideal for those who enjoy a distinct vanilla-like taste.

2. Experimenting with Flavor Profiles: Getting adventurous

Don’t be afraid to venture beyond the ordinary and sprinkle some flavor magic into your chocolate chip cookies. Consider these delectable variations:

  • Mint Chocolate Chips: Infuse your cookies with a refreshing burst of minty goodness. The coolness of mint and the richness of chocolate create a harmonious symphony on your taste buds.
  • Toffee Bits: Add a delightful crunch and a hint of caramel flavor by incorporating toffee bits into your cookies. They will transform your ordinary cookies into a textural wonderland.
  • Butterscotch Chips: Embrace the warm, buttery sweetness of butterscotch chips. Their smooth, caramel-like taste will have you reaching for seconds (or thirds!).
  • Peanut Butter Chips: Create a divine marriage of chocolate and peanut butter by using peanut butter chips. It’s like having a tiny Reese’s Peanut Butter Cup in every bite.

3. Size Matters: Tiny chips or mighty chunks?

The size of your chocolate chips can greatly impact the texture and overall experience of your cookies. Consider these options:

  • Regular Chocolate Chips: The classic choice, providing a balanced distribution of chocolate throughout the cookie dough. They melt smoothly and create that iconic chocolate chip cookie appearance.
  • Mini Chocolate Chips: If you’re after a more delicate and evenly dispersed chocolate presence, opt for mini chocolate chips. They offer a delightful mini-chocolate explosion in every bite.
  • Chocolate Chunks: For those who crave gooey pockets of chocolate goodness, chocolate chunks are the answer. Their larger size provides a satisfyingly melty center in each cookie.

4. Quality Matters: Invest in the best

Remember, the quality of your chocolate chips can make or break your chocolate chip cookies. Here are some tips to ensure you’re using top-notch chocolate:

  • Look for High Cocoa Content: Higher cocoa percentages often indicate better quality chocolate chips. Aim for at least 60% cocoa content for a rich and intense chocolate flavor.
  • Check Ingredient List: Avoid chocolate chips that contain hydrogenated oils or artificial additives. Opt for those with a simple ingredient list, focusing on cocoa, sugar, and natural flavors.
  • Brands to Trust: Some popular brands known for their quality chocolate chips include Ghirardelli, Guittard, Valrhona, and Callebaut. Give them a try if you’re feeling adventurous!

Mastering the Perfect Texture

Ah, texture—the crispy, chewy, gooey symphony of sensations that dance upon our palates. Achieving the ideal texture in your chocolate chip cookies requires a delicate balance of ingredients and baking techniques. Let’s unlock the secrets to cookie texture nirvana!

1. The Chewiness Factor: Finding your sweet spot

Chewiness is a sought-after quality in chocolate chip cookies, offering a delightful balance between tenderness and resistance. Here’s how you can tailor the chewiness level to your liking:

  • Adjust Sugar Ratio: Increase the ratio of brown sugar to granulated sugar for a chewier texture. The moisture content of brown sugar contributes to a softer, more tender cookie.
  • Underbake Slightly: To achieve a chewy center, remove your cookies from the oven just before they fully set. They will continue to bake on the hot baking sheet, resulting in a perfectly chewy texture.
  • Add Cornstarch: For an extra touch of chewiness, try adding a teaspoon of cornstarch to your dry ingredients. It helps retain moisture, resulting in a softer cookie.

2. Crispy Edges and Gooey Centers: The best of both worlds

The holy grail of chocolate chip cookies—a delicate balance between crispy edges and a soft, gooey center. Here’s how you can achieve this delightful contrast:

  • Chill the Dough: After mixing your cookie dough, chilling it in the refrigerator for at least an hour (or overnight) allows the flavors to meld and the dough to firm up. This results in less spreading during baking and a higher chance of crisp edges.
  • Increase Butter-to-Flour Ratio: A higher ratio of butter to flour can lead to more spread during baking, creating those coveted crispy edges.
  • Use Baking Powder: Including a small amount of baking powder (in addition to baking soda) can help create a bit more lift and spread, contributing to crispy edges.

3. Customizing Thickness: Thin or thick, the choice is yours

The thickness of your chocolate chip cookies is a matter of personal preference. Whether you prefer thin and delicate cookies or thick and substantial ones, here’s how to achieve your desired thickness:

  • For Thin Cookies: Increase the ratio of granulated sugar to brown sugar. Granulated sugar encourages more spreading during baking, resulting in thinner cookies.
  • For Thick Cookies: Increase the ratio of brown sugar to granulated sugar. Brown sugar contributes to a softer, moister cookie with less spread, resulting in a thicker cookie.

4. The Perfect Bake Time: Timing is everything

Finding the ideal bake time is crucial to achieving the desired texture in your cookies. Here are some tips to guide you:

  • Underbake for Chewy Texture: If you prefer a chewy texture, remove your cookies from the oven when the edges are just golden brown, and the centers are still slightly soft. They will continue to set as they cool.
  • Golden Brown for Balanced Texture: For a balanced texture with slightly crispy edges and a soft center, bake your cookies until they are a light golden brown all over.
  • Crispy All the Way: If you’re a fan of crispy cookies, extend the baking time until the edges are deep golden brown. Be careful not to overbake, as they can quickly turn dry and brittle.

1. Salt: The Unsung Hero

Salt may seem like a small ingredient, but it plays a crucial role in balancing the sweetness and enhancing the overall flavor of your cookies. Here’s how to make the most of it:

  • Use Kosher or Sea Salt: The larger crystals of kosher or sea salt provide a delightful burst of flavor and texture when sprinkled on top of your cookies.
  • Add a Pinch to the Dough: Incorporating a small amount of salt directly into the cookie dough enhances the sweetness of the chocolate and other ingredients.

2. Extracts and Flavorings: Adding a Twist

While classic chocolate chip cookies are always a crowd-pleaser, adding extracts and flavorings can elevate your cookies to new heights. Here are some ideas to inspire your creativity:

  • Almond Extract: Add a touch of almond extract to impart a subtle nutty undertone to your cookies.
  • Coconut Extract: Transport your taste buds to a tropical paradise by incorporating a hint of coconut extract. Pair it with white chocolate chips for an exotic twist.
  • Orange Zest: Grate some fresh orange zest into your cookie dough for a vibrant citrus flavor that complements the richness of the chocolate.

3. Nuts: Crunchy Delights

Nuts not only add a delightful crunch to your chocolate chip cookies but also bring their unique flavors to the mix. Here are some popular choices:

  • Walnuts: The classic nut choice for chocolate chip cookies, walnuts provide a rich, earthy flavor that pairs well with the sweetness of the chocolate.
  • Pecans: For a slightly sweeter and buttery flavor, pecans are an excellent option. They add a touch of indulgence to your cookies.
  • Macadamia Nuts: Indulge in the buttery richness of macadamia nuts, offering a delicate and creamy texture to your cookies.

4. Enhancements: Taking it up a notch

Sometimes, a little extra something can take your chocolate chip cookies from great to extraordinary. Consider these fun and flavorful enhancements:

  • Toasted Coconut: Toast shredded coconut until golden brown and sprinkle it on top of your cookies before baking. It adds a delightful tropical twist.
  • Cinnamon: Add a pinch of cinnamon to your cookie dough for a warm and cozy flavor profile that pairs beautifully with the chocolate.
  • Espresso Powder: For coffee lovers, a teaspoon of espresso powder adds depth and richness to your cookies, intensifying the chocolate flavor.

1. The Art of Measuring: Precision is key

Accurate measurement is the backbone of baking success. To ensure your cookies turn out just right, follow these measuring guidelines:

  • Use Measuring Cups and Spoons: Invest in a good set of measuring cups and spoons to ensure accurate and consistent measurements.
  • Fluff and Scoop: When measuring dry ingredients such as flour, fluff it up with a fork, then gently scoop it into the measuring cup and level it off with a straight edge.
  • Weighing Ingredients: For the utmost precision, consider using a kitchen scale to weigh your ingredients, especially when working with chocolate chips and nuts.

2. Room Temperature Ingredients: Embrace the warmth

Using room temperature ingredients can greatly impact the texture and overall outcome of your cookies. Here’s why it matters:

  • Butter: Softened butter incorporates more air into the dough, resulting in lighter and tender cookies. Allow your butter to sit at room temperature for about 30 minutes before baking.
  • Eggs: Room temperature eggs blend more easily into the dough, ensuring even distribution and a smoother texture.

3. Chilling the Dough: Patience is a virtue

While it may be tempting to skip this step in your eagerness to indulge in warm cookies, chilling the dough is a crucial step for optimal flavor and texture. Here’s why:

  • Prevent Excessive Spreading: Chilled dough holds its shape better during baking, resulting in cookies with a more desirable thickness and less spread.
  • Enhance Flavor Development: Chilling the dough allows the flavors to meld and intensify, resulting in a more complex and delicious cookie.

4. The Scoop Technique: Uniformity matters

Achieving perfectly round and uniform cookies not only makes them visually appealing but also ensures even baking. Master the scoop technique with these tips:

  • Use a Cookie Scoop: A cookie scoop ensures consistent portioning and yields cookies of the same size, ensuring even baking.
  • Space Them Out: When placing the dough onto the baking sheet, leave enough space between the cookies to allow for spreading. This prevents them from merging into one giant cookie!

5. Oven Temperature and Rack Placement: The heat is on

The correct oven temperature and rack placement are crucial factors in achieving the perfect bake. Here’s what you need to know:

  • Preheating: Always preheat your oven to the specified temperature before baking your cookies. This ensures even baking and consistent results.
  • Rack Placement: For best results, position your baking rack in the center of the oven. This allows for even heat distribution and prevents the tops or bottoms of the cookies from burning.

6. The Golden Rule: Timing is everything

Knowing when your cookies are perfectly baked can be the difference between soft, chewy bliss and dry, crumbly disappointment. Keep these guidelines in mind:

  • Watch for the Edges: Pay attention to the edges of your cookies—they should be golden brown, indicating that they’re done.
  • Soft Centers: The centers may still appear slightly underbaked when you remove the cookies from the oven, but they will firm up as they cool. Trust the process!
